html {
    height: 100%;
}

body {
	background-repeat: no-repeat;
	background: #2a3240;
    
   text-align             : center;
   padding-top            : 10px;
   padding-bottom         : 0px;
   padding-left           : 0px;
   padding-right          : 0px;
   margin                 : 0px;
   width				  : 800px;
   vertical-align		  : top;	
   margin				  : 0px auto;

}

td.nav {
   text-align             : left;
   vertical-align         : top;
   
}
td.body {
	text-align             : left;
	vertical-align         : top;
}
TD {
	font-family:				Verdana,Geneva,Arial,Helvetica;
	font-size:					9pt;
	color:						#2a3240;
}
h1, h2, h3, h4, h5, h6{
	margin-top: 5px;
	padding-left: 3px;
	border-bottom: 2px solid #2a3240;
	text-align: left;
	}
H1,H2,H3{font-size:20pt;font-weight:normal;margin-bottom:6px;text-align: left;color:#2a3240;}
H4{font-size:12pt;font-weight:normal;margin-bottom:6px;}
ul.menulevel1,ul.menulevel2,ul.menulevel3,ul.sitemaplevel1,ul.sitemaplevel2,ul.sitemaplevel3,ul.submenu,ul.search{padding-left: 0;margin-left: 0;list-style: none;}
form{margin:0;}
IMG{border:0;}
li{line-height:1.5;}
.doc{padding-left: 20px;background-image: url(menu/document.png);background-repeat: no-repeat;}
.docs{padding-left:20px;background-image: url(menu/documents.png);background-repeat:no-repeat;}
.sdoc{padding-left: 20px;background-image: url(menu/sdocument.png);background-repeat: no-repeat;}
.sdocs{padding-left: 20px;background-image: url(menu/sdocuments.png);background-repeat: no-repeat;}
a{text-decoration:none;font-weight:normal;}
a:link,a:visited{color:#2a3240;}
a:active,a:hover{color:#000000;font-weight:bold;}
.sitename{font-weight:normal;font-size:20pt;}
.menulevel1{font-size:8pt;color:#000000;}
.menulevel1 a{font-weight:normal;color:#000000;}
.menulevel1 a:link,.menulevel1 a:visited{color:#000000;}
.menulevel1 a:active,.menulevel1 a:hover{color:#000000;font-weight:bold;}
.menulevel2{font-size:8pt;color:#000000;}
.menulevel2 a{font-weight:normal;color:#000000;}
.menulevel2 a:link,.menulevel2 a:visited{color:#000000;}
.menulevel2 a:active,.menulevel2 a:hover{color:#000000;font-weight:bold;}
.menulevel3{font-size:8pt;color:#000000;}
.menulevel3 a{font-weight:normal;color:#000000;}
.menulevel3 a:link,.menulevel3 a:visited{color:#000000;}
.menulevel3 a:active,.menulevel3 a:hover{color:#000000;font-weight:bold;}
.sitemaplevel1,.sitemaplevel2,.sitemaplevel3{font-size:9pt;}
.sitemaplevel1 a,.sitemaplevel2 a,.sitemaplevel3 a{color:#000000;}
.sitemaplevel1 a:link,.sitemaplevel2 a:link,.sitemaplevel3 a:link,.sitemaplevel1 a:visited,.sitemaplevel2 a:visited,.sitemaplevel3 a:visited{color:#000000;}
.sitemaplevel1 a:active,.sitemaplevel2 a:active,.sitemaplevel3 a:active,.sitemaplevel1 a:hover,.sitemaplevel2 a:hover,.sitemaplevel3 a:hover{color:#000000;font-weight:bold;}
.submenu{font-size:9pt;text-align:left;}
.submenu a{font-weight:normal;color:#000000;}
.submenu a:link,.submenu a:visited{color:#000000;}
.submenu a:active,.submenu a:hover{color:#000000;font-weight:bold;}
.search a{font-weight:normal;color:#000000;}
.search a:link,.search a:visited{color:#000000;}
.search a:active,.search a:hover{color:#000000;}
.locator{font-size:8pt;color:white;}
.locator a{font-weight:normal;text-decoration:underline}
.locator a:link,.locator a:visited,.locator a:active,.locator a:hover{color:white;}
.menu{font-weight:bold;font-size:8pt;color:white;}
.menu a{text-decoration:underline;color:white;}
.menu a:link,.menu a:visited,.menu a:active,.menu a:hover{color:white;}
.login{font-weight:bold;font-size:8pt;color:grey;}
.login a,.login a:link,.login a:visited,.login a:active,.login a:hover{color:gray;}
.navigator{font-weight:bold;font-size:10pt;color:white;}
.navigator a:link,.navigator a:visited{color:#c0c0c0;}
.navigator a:active,.navigator a:hover{color:white;}
.edit{font-size:8pt;color:black;background-color:buttonface;}
.edit a:link,.edit a:visited,.edit a:active,.edit a:hover{font-weight:normal;color:black;}
input,select{font-size:8pt;}
textarea{font-family:Verdana,Geneva,Arial,Helvetica;font-size:8pt;background-color:white;width:98%;}
.searchbox .text,.searchbox .submit{border:2px solid #c0c0c0;background-color:white;}
.imgboxl {
	background-image: url('<?php echo $pth['folder']['templateimages']?>_images/nav1_lft.png') left top ;
   background-repeat: repeat-y;
   width						  : 100%;
}
td.b1x5 {
   background             : #e6e6e6;
   text-align             : left;
   vertical-align         : top;
   width						  : 150px;
}
td.b1x5b {
   background             : #e6e6e6;
   text-align             : left;
   vertical-align         : top;
   width						  : 630px;
}
td.b1x5t {

   text-align             : center;
   vertical-align         : top;
   width						  : 800px;
}
/*///////////////////////////////////////////////////////////////////////////////////////////////////////*/
/* TABLEAU */
/* Style des lignes de séparation */
.table-separateur {
  font-size : 13px;
  font-family : Verdana, arial, helvetica, sans-serif;
  color : #e6e6e6;
  background-color : #aaaaaa;
}
/* Style des en-têtes du tableau */
.table-entete {
  font-size : 13px;
  font-family : Verdana, arial, helvetica, sans-serif;
  color : #e6e6e6;
  background-color : #386880;
}
/* Style 1 des cellules */
.table-ligne1 {
  padding : 4px;
  text-align : top;  
  font-size : 11px;
  font-family : Verdana, arial, helvetica, sans-serif;
  color : #ffffff;
  background-color : #386880;
}
/* Style 2 des cellules */
.table-ligne2 {
  padding : 4px;
  text-align : top;
  font-size : 11px;
  font-family : Verdana, arial, helvetica, sans-serif;
  color : #ffffff;
  background-color : #2a3240;
}
.tiny{
font-size:9px;
}
.imgcat {
  	padding :0px;
  	display:block;
	float:right;
	margin: 10px 10px 10px 10px;
	border-style:solid;
	border-width:2px;
	
}
.imgcatl {
  	padding :0px;
  	display:block;
	float:left;
	margin: 10px 10px 10px 10px;
	border-style:solid;
	border-width:2px;
	
}
.imgcat1{
  	padding :5px;
	margin: 0px 10px 0px 0px;
	
.gal{
	text-align : center;
	border-color: #ffffff
	border-style:solid;
	border-width:10px;
}

}
#titlet {
color:#52504e;
font-size:10px;
font-weight:bold;
}

/*** set the width and height to match your images **/
#slideshow {
	margin:10px;
    position:relative;
    display:block;
	float:right;
    height:225px;
    Width:300px;
    border-style:solid;
	border-width:2px;
}

#slideshow IMG {
    position:absolute;
    top:0;
    left:0;
    z-index:8;
    opacity:0.0;
}

#slideshow IMG.active {
    z-index:10;
    opacity:1.0;  
}


#slideshow IMG.last-active {
    z-index:9;
}

#slideshowl {
	margin-right:10px;
    position:relative;
    display:block;
	float:left;
    height:300px;
    Width:225px;
    border-style:solid;
	border-width:2px;
}

#slideshowl IMG {
    position:absolute;
    top:0;
    left:0;
    z-index:8;
    opacity:0.0;
}

#slideshowl IMG.active {
    z-index:10;
    opacity:1.0;  
}


#slideshowl IMG.last-active {
    z-index:9;
}

